Intellicheck, Inc. (IDN) - VRIO Analysis: 1. Proprietary DMV ID Analysis Technology
You’re looking at the core engine of Intellicheck, Inc. (IDN), and honestly, it’s the reason they command premium pricing and maintain such high profitability. This isn't just another scanner; it's deep intellectual property that underpins their entire value proposition in the identity verification space.
Value: Trusted, Real-Time Identity Verification
The technology creates trusted, real-time identity verification by uniquely analyzing DMV-issued IDs. This is critical for stopping fraud and enabling fast customer onboarding. The proof is in the performance metrics they report for their Q3 2025 operations.
- Delivers 99.975% decisioning success rate.
- Decisioning time is consistently in under a second.
- Processes transactions for nearly half the adult population in the US and Canada annually.
Rarity: The Only SaaS Service with This Method
Yes, Intellicheck is described as the only Software as a Service (SaaS) platform using this specific, proprietary analysis method for DMV IDs. Competitors relying on standard Optical Character Recognition (OCR) simply cannot match this depth of insight.
Imitability: Difficult, Built Over Decades
Replicating this is tough. This isn't something a competitor can build in a year; it’s specialized intellectual property developed over 25 years of running the AAMVA Driver’s License/ID Card Verification Program. That long-standing relationship with issuing jurisdictions provides access to authoritative data that others lack.
Organization: Entire Business Model is Aligned
The company is definitely organized around this core engine. Their ability to translate this tech into profit is clear from their recent financial performance. The entire service offering is built to capitalize on this unique capability, which drives their high margins.
| Metric | Q3 2025 Value |
| Gross Profit Margin | 91% |
| Total Revenue (Q3 2025) | $6,014,000 |
| SaaS Revenue (Q3 2025) | $5,868,000 |
| Net Income (Q3 2025) | $290,000 |
Competitive Advantage: Sustained
Because this specialized, hard-to-replicate technology is central to their value proposition and directly results in industry-leading margins, the advantage here is Sustained. If you’re investing, this technology moat is what you’re betting on.

Intellicheck, Inc. (IDN) - VRIO Analysis: 2. Industry-Leading Decisioning Accuracy and Speed
Value: Intellicheck delivers 99.975% decisioning success rate in under a second. The company validates around 100 million identities across North America annually.
Rarity: Management claims no competitor matches the specific 99.975% accuracy rate.
Imitability: Competitors are using AI to close the gap. For instance, one competitor's Document Verification solution achieved 98.2% true accept rates in 1.5 seconds (p99 speed).
Organization: This performance metric supports securing multi-year agreements with financial services clients. SaaS revenue for Q2 ended June 30, 2025, totaled $5,080,000, a 10% increase year-over-year.
Competitive Advantage: The current metric is a strong selling point, but the technology race continues.
| Metric | Intellicheck (IDN) Stated Performance | Competitor Performance Data Found |
| Decisioning Accuracy | 99.975% | 98.2% true accept rates (DocV solution) |
| Decisioning Speed | Under a second | 1.5 seconds (p99 speed for DocV) |
| Fraud Capture (Top 3% Riskiest) | Not explicitly stated for this segment | Captured 92% of ID fraud |
| Reported Fraud Loss Reduction | Implied by accuracy | 80% reduction in fraud losses |
Relevant Statistical and Financial Data:
- Q2 2025 Total Revenue: $5,123,000.
- Q2 2025 Net Loss: ($251,000).
- Q2 2025 Adjusted EBITDA: $75,000 (improvement from loss of ($70,000) in Q2 2024).
- Full Year 2024 Revenue: Just short of $20 million.
- Full Year 2024 Net Loss: $918,000.
- Competitor (Socure) Verified Identity Requests in 2024: Over 2.7 billion.
- Competitor (Socure) GAAP Revenue Growth YoY 2024: 54%.
Intellicheck, Inc. (IDN) - VRIO Analysis: 3. High-Margin, Recurring SaaS Revenue Model
Value: The model provides predictable revenue streams and high profitability.
SaaS revenue constituted approximately 98% of total Q3 2025 revenue at $5,868,000 out of total revenue of $6,014,000.
| Metric | Q3 2025 Amount | YoY Change |
| Total Revenue | $6,014,000 | 28% increase |
| SaaS Revenue | $5,868,000 | 26% increase |
| Gross Profit Margin | 90.5% | Comparable to Q3 2024 |
Many fintechs utilize a SaaS model; however, the achieved margin profile is a differentiating factor.
- Gross Profit as a percentage of revenues for Q3 2025 was 90.5%.
- Adjusted Gross Margin improved to 92.8% in Q3 2025 from 91.5% in Q3 2024.
Competitors can adopt a subscription model, but matching the current margin structure presents difficulty.
- Q3 2025 Gross Profit Margin was 90.5%.
- Q3 2025 Operating Expenses were $5,205,000, relatively flat compared to $5,195,000 in Q3 2024.
- Net Income for Q3 2025 was $290,000, compared to a net loss of ($837,000) in Q3 2024.
The organization demonstrates focus on efficiency by actively managing infrastructure costs.
- The company is migrating customers away from Microsoft Azure, which is gradually improving margins.
- Adjusted EBITDA improved by $798,000 to $631,000 in Q3 2025 from a loss of ($167,000) in Q3 2024.
- Non-cash stock-based compensation expense was $204,000 in Q3 2025, down from $237,000 in Q3 2024.
The model is common in the industry, but the realized high margin is a current strength requiring continuous defense.
The Q3 2025 Adjusted Gross Margin was 92.8%.

Intellicheck, Inc. (IDN) - VRIO Analysis: 5. Diversified Industry Vertical Penetration
Value: Diversification away from retail seasonality into higher-value sectors like banking, title insurance, and auto reduces revenue volatility. The full-year 2024 Net Loss of ($918,000) improved significantly from the full-year 2023 Net Loss of ($1,980,000).
Rarity: No. Most ID verification firms serve multiple sectors.
Imitability: Easy. Competitors can target the same verticals, though it takes time to build relationships.
Organization: Yes. The strategy successfully offset headwinds from 'retail contraction' in 2024, evidenced by the full-year 2024 Total Revenue growth of 6% to $19,997,000 despite retail issues.
Competitive Advantage: Temporary. It's a successful strategy, but the markets are not exclusive, so others will follow. Intellicheck targets 24% of its 2025 revenue from straight-line multi-year contracts.
The strategic pivot is reflected in the following comparative financial data:
| Metric | Year Ended December 31, 2023 | Year Ended December 31, 2024 |
|---|---|---|
| Total Revenue | $18,906,000 | $19,997,000 |
| SaaS Revenue | $18,595,000 | $19,810,000 |
| Net Loss | ($1,980,000) | ($918,000) |
| Gross Profit Margin | 92.7% | 90.8% |
Growth is being driven by penetration into specific, higher-value verticals:
- Retail banking growth noted in Q1 2025 results.
- Title insurance segment surge, with 2-year deals expected to generate 6-digit annual recurring revenue streams.
- Auto sector expansion mentioned in Q1 2025 updates.
- Logistics and shipping market vertical progress reported.
